Australia’s waistline is bulging

Very few people would claim to be happy with their weight and while most of us wouldn‘t consider ourselves obese, a new report suggests that almost half of the Australian population does indeed fall into this category.

A report by the Australian Institute of Health and Welfare (AIHW) has found that 63.4 per cent of adults in Australia are classified as obese – with a BMI over 30.

Country South Australia has the highest population of obese adults, with 73 per cent base don 2013-14 figures collected by the AIHW.
